Attorney Jeremy Eldridge, a former prosecutor for the Baltimore City State’s Attorney’s Office, has extensive trial experience, having managed hundreds of judge and jury trials. His background in cases involving felony drugs, domestic violence, theft, fraud, DUI/DWI, homicide, handguns, and burglary has equipped him with a comprehensive understanding of Maryland’s criminal justice system. Now in private practice, Mr. Eldridge represents clients facing various criminal charges, recognizing the often-overlooked collateral consequences of convictions, including immigration-related issues. His fluency in Spanish enables him to communicate directly with clients who speak little or no English, especially when they face legal challenges beyond criminal charges. Mr. Eldridge also advocates for clients in appeals, leveraging his prosecutorial experience to provide robust representation against the state’s resources. Known for his attentive and compassionate approach, Mr. Eldridge is dedicated to making the legal process as clear and manageable as possible for his clients.
